检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
打包、安装和运行一步到位,详情请参见快速发布与部署AstroZero开发的应用。 发布 > 发布版本:发布应用的新版本。通过发布版本,可以将当前应用升迁至新版本,之后的开发将在新版本上进行。 发布 > 生成安装包:首次安装或升级应用时,可选择该打包方式,详情请参见发布与部署AstroZero开发应用的安装包或补丁包。
下划线结尾。 showDataInfo 版本 URL对应的版本号。 1.0.0 URL 新URL地址,其中“/service”是固定值,其次是“/App名称/版本号”,剩下部分请自定义。 /showDataInfo 类型 选择新建接口的类型。 脚本 资源 选择接口调用的脚本。 选择5中创建的脚本
内容类型 请求中的body类型,支持如下三大类: application/json multipart/form-data binary-data “multipart/form-data”和“binary-data”用于文件上传接口,选择该内容类型,只能调用POST类型的脚本。
专享版:提供了500个、2000个和5000个用户数(包括业务用户)供选择。 变更实例 表2 变更实例约束与限制 限制项 约束与限制 变更AstroZero实例规格/类型 建议在业务低峰期变更实例,业务高峰期变更实例可能会失败。 免费版实例不支持升级规格。 标准版可以升级到专业版。 标准版、专业版无法升级到专享版,只能单独购买。
创建“查询维修人员”、“派单功能”脚本对应的公共接口,详细接口信息如表1所示。 加粗斜体内容请替换为实际命名空间前缀。 表1 公共接口 设置操作 版本 URL 方法 类型 资源 queryWorker 1.0.0 /queryWorker GET 脚本 HW__queryWorker dispatchWorkOrder
图2 公共接口创建 创建“处理工单”、“判断下一步状态”脚本对应的公共接口,详细接口信息如表1所示。 表1 公共接口 设置操作 版本 URL 方法 类型 资源 modifyOrderStatus 1.0.0 /modifyOrderStatus POST 脚本 HW__modifyOrderStatus
查看AstroZero账号的业务阈值 创建AstroZero实例时,系统会根据所选的规格分配不同级别的业务阈值,从而对账号分配相应的系统资源。本章节将指导您查看当前账号下可以再创建多少App、应用菜单、服务编排、流程编排等,以及查看该账号是否具有数据接入、高级页面等功能。 查看业务阈值
如果在“资源”下拉框中,未找到需要关联的脚本或服务编排,请检查相关脚本和服务编排是否已启用,加粗斜体内容以实际命名空间前缀为准。 表1 公共接口 设置操作 版本 URL 方法 类型 资源 login 1.0.0 /login POST 服务编排 HW__login registerPortalUser 1.0
有内容。 内容类型 请求中的body类型。 application/json multipart/form-data binary-data “multipart/form-data”和“binary-data”用于文件上传接口,选择该内容类型,只能调用POST类型的事件。 默认值:application/json。
出现该提示的原因是:该应用并非当前租户原生开发,而是从其他租户通过源码包方式安装而来的,而且其他租户已发布过相同版本的该应用。 处理方法:当前租户发布该应用到我的仓库时,设置全新的版本号进行发布,避免版本号和其他租户重复。 应用发布后,其他租户可以在开发环境、沙箱环境和运行环境中安装软件包,以便于测试或者使用该软件。
应用创建后,该应用站点默认处于被解锁状态。 在进行高级页面相关配置前,需要先单击,锁定页面。 锁定后,该站点所有页面将会被自动保存,并更新至最新版本。 在“常用”页签,配置页面的基本属性。 表1 页面常用配置 参数 参数说明 站点名 系统默认生成的站点名,不可修改。创建应用时,系统默认会创建并分配一个站点。
代码所属的仓库分支。 字符串类型参数。 默认值为“master”。 不是私密参数。 打开“运行时设置”开关,表示单独执行构建任务时支持变更参数值,并且也会把该参数上报流水线。 状态为“已使用”,记录参数已被使用。 releaseVersion 流水线版本号。 自增长类型参数。 默认值不用配
应用所属的分类。设置分类后,工程列表和库列表都可以根据应用或BO的分类进行筛选。 描述 轻应用的描述信息。 运行时版本 开发的资产包依赖所选择的运行时版本,若线下运行版本不一致,可能产生不兼容。 展开“高级设置”时,才会显示该参数。 系统会自动创建该轻应用,创建后,显示页面如下。 图5
系统预置库是系统已定义好的库,可在页面设计中直接进行加载并使用。如何查看系统预置的库,请参见管理库。 图1 系统预置的库 系统预置库的版本号是在资源上传或更新时,平台赋予的版本管理号,和实际官网版本不存在对应关系。 自定义库 当系统预置的库无法满足用户需求时,用户可以上传自定义库包,并加载到页面中进行使用。
件更新。 图7 在线开发组件示例 此时组件代码已更新完成,组件版本已升级,但是在高级页面中所用的组件还是更新之前的版本,用户需要参考图8,在所在应用的“页面设置”中,主动升级后才能生效。 图8 升级组件 更新组件版本。 在经典设计器页面,单击页面下方的“页面设置”。在弹出的页面中
主页 打开华为OneMobile小程序时,默认展示的页面。 环境类型 承载应用程序服务的AstroZero环境类型,如“开发环境”、“运行环境”和“沙箱”。 运行环境/沙箱域名 设置运行环境/沙箱的环境域名。当“环境类型”配置为“运行环境”或“沙箱”时,该参数才需要配置。 运行环境/沙箱租户ID
更改历史:在该页签可查看该组件的历史版本(按照版本依次排序显示,最近版本号在最上面),可下载具体版本对应的组件包。 包信息:显示依赖的库。 全局组件和受保护的自定义组件只可预览、下载和查看。 在未受保护的组件详情页,单击“更新”,可更新组件包。更新后,已用到该组件的页面中该组件版本还未更新,可执行如下操作进行更新。
系统预置库是系统已定义好的库,可在页面设计中直接进行加载并使用。如何查看系统预置的库,请参见管理库。 图1 系统预置库 系统预置库的版本号是在资源上传或更新时,平台赋予的版本管理号,和实际官网版本不存在对应关系。 自定义库 当系统预置的库无法满足用户需求时,用户可以上传自定义库包,并加载到页面中进行使用。
置态流程。 在“运行实例”页面中,可查看正在运行的配置态流程实例。 每当运行配置态流程时,系统会产生一个配置态流程实例,并给该实例分配一个实例ID,用于标识该实例。配置态流程运行结束后,系统将会自动删除实例ID。 表1 “运行实例”页面说明 参数 说明 实例ID 每当配置态流程运
更改历史:在该页签可查看该组件的历史版本(按照版本依次排序显示,最近版本号在最上面),可下载具体版本对应的组件包。 包信息:显示依赖的库。 全局组件和受保护的自定义组件只可预览、下载和查看。 在未受保护的组件详情页,单击“更新”,更新组件包。更新后,已用到该组件的页面中该组件版本还未更新。需要在已